I think the author wrote it so well that I have to save it. Understanding of this example: //Type parameters cannot use basic types. T and U are actually the same type. //Every time new data is placed, it becomes a new top. Push the original top down one level and establish a link through the pointer. //The end sentinel is a node created by the default constructor that is consistent with end() returning true. //: generics/LinkedStack.java
// A stack implemented with an internal linked structure.
package generics;
public class LinkedStack
1. Generic implementation in Java programming thinking shares a stack class
Introduction: This article introduces the generic implementation of a stack class in Java programming ideas. Friends in need can refer to it
2. java stack class usage example (how to use stack in java)
Introduction: How to use stack in Java. The stack is a "last in first out" (LIFO) data structure. Data can only be inserted (called "push") or deleted (called "pop") at one end. Operation, let’s look at the example below
3. Generic implementation of a stack class in Java programming ideas
Introduction: This article introduces the generic implementation of a stack class in Java programming ideas. Friends in need can refer to it
The above is the detailed content of Recommended tutorials about stack classes. For more information, please follow other related articles on the PHP Chinese website!